Nintendo DSi XL turns into ebook reader

Guess Nintendo knows that ebooks could very well be the next big thing, so why not push forward the advantage of its DSi XL’s larger display (4.2″) by offering a downloadable package of ebooks known as 100 classic books, where it will hit Wii channels this coming June 14th onwards for $20. Guess classics will never grow old, and we hope to relive the adventures of The Three Musketeers and Little Men on Nintendo’s wildly successful handheld console. Of course, the mentioned titles are just speculation on our part, but if those don’t make it to the list of classics, we do question the standard of quality being applied there.
